Kelseyville won the last time they faced Willits and things went their way on Thursday too. The Knights came out on top against the Wolverines by a score of 2-0. Give Kelseyville's defense some credit: that's the team's fourth straight shutout.
Alex Jimenez and Sebastian Cacho scored both of Kelseyville's goals, bringing their combined season tally to 26 goals.
Kelseyville's win was their third straight at home, which pushed their record up to 13-5-2. Those home victories came thanks in part to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they scored 14 goals over those three matches. As for Willits, they are on a three-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 6-11-1.
Coming up, Kelseyville will challenge International at 4:00 p.m. on Monday. As for Willits, they will square off against Upper Lake at 4:30 p.m. on Tuesday. Willits will be up against Upper Lake's rather soft defense (which has allowed 4.72 goals per matchup), so fans could be in store for a big offensive performance.
